Compare The Villages to Doral

This post compares The Villages, Florida to Doral, Florida across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ension The Villages (CDP) Doral (city)
Population 74,618 56,276
Income (median) $51,366 $46,093
Home Value (median) $263,700 $349,800
White 98% 91%
Black 0% 2%
Asian 0% 3%
With Kids 0% 51%
Age (median) 70 35
Rentals 3% 50%
